About
We give workshops in World's smallest chocolate factory in Englisch, German and Dutch. There's a workshop Chocolate and Wine (max 6 participants), a workshop Chocolate and Tea (also max 6 participants) and a workshop Chocolate Tempering (max 5 participants). We also have the online workshops Chocolate and Wine, and Chocolate and tea, which you can do where ever you are in the world (some of this could depend on the import rules of your country). Please take a look at our website for more information or signing up. Or send us an email with your question! In World's smallest chocolate factory we make balanced recipes by combining beautiful and powerful chocolate and the best ingredients (hand made - fair trade). Our products are sold, amongst other locations, in our web shop, at the Maastricht Visitor Centre and several shops in The Netherlands, Germany and Belgium.

The workshop was a lot of fun for us (4 girls on a hen weekend). We were greeted warmly and had a short reception before getting to work. Each participant gets a chance to "make" chocolate and there is plenty to try/eat. By the end of the workshop, our group had made several kinds of treats that we could take with us. Arnout, the chocolatier, is very warm, patient, and easy to communicate with. He speaks and writes English very well so don't worry about that. The chocolate "factory" is more of a kitchen so it's a comfortable environment (i.e., not noisy and industrial). The group has to agree on the light/darkness of the chocolate so be prepared to specify that.
